Frank Iero was standing by the river looking at the stepping stones and remembering each one. There was the round unsteady stone, the pointed one, the flat one in the middle - the safe stone where you could stand and look around.

The next wasn't so safe for when the river was full the water flowed over it and even when it looked dry, it was slippery. But after that it was easy and soon he was on the other side.

Frank pulled a lose thread at his hoodie as he walked up the familier road. The road seemed more fierce than usual but Frank payed no attention to it as he walked along feeling extraordinarily happy.

He was so lost in his thoughts that he almost walked straight through a load of flowers and cards on the corner of a bend.

The young boy shook his head and carried on walking. Frank came to the worn steps that led up to the house and his heart began to beat. The treehouse was missing but the pine tree was still there and at the top of the steps the rough lawn stretched away, just as he remembered it. Frank stopped and looked at the house which looked like it hadn't been painted in a while.

Quickly, Frank recognised the two people under the big mango tree, one had black hair and had his knees tucked up to his chest, the other looked as if he was comforting him.

He waved at them and called out "Hey guys!" but they didn't answer or turn their heads. The grass was yellow in the hot sunlight as he walked towards them. When he was quite close he called again, happily "You alright?" Then "I'm back!"

Still they didn't answer. When for the third time "I'm sorry I left, but I swear I'm back!" Frank was quite near them and his arms instinctively went out, with the longing to touch them.

It was Gerard who turned. His usually bright eyes, dull and looking straight into Frank's. his expression didn't change.

Gerard sighed and then spoke quietly.

"It's gotten really cold all of a sudden, you notice Mikey?"

"Yeah, let's go inside"

Frank's arms fell to his side as he watched their images disapear into the house.

That was the first time he knew.
